King are launching M88, a full-service representation firm that aims to amplify “the voices of artists and creators from the global new majority.”Sun will depart the agency to lead the new joint venture as president and managing partner, and King’s recently launched Macro Management will merge its operations with the company.
M88, which gets its first initial from King’s Macro and the numbers in its name as a nod to Sun’s Chinese heritage, will be majority-owned by Macro.
Macro Management partners Gaby Mena and Jelani Johnson are also boarding M88.Michael B. Jordan will be M88’s first client, with more expected to be represented by the firm soon.
